John McCullough Sr.

John D. McCullough, 81 of Indianapolis died Sunday Dec. 28, 2014 at his residence. John was born March 21, 1933, the son of H. Clifford & Dorothy McCullough of Findlay Ohio. He was a graduate of The Ohio State University.  He was an instrument rated pilot & served in the U.S. Marine Corps. He was retired from Navistar International. He is proceeded in death by his brother, Dr. David Clifford McCullough. He is survived by his sons, John D. McCullough, Jr & H. Clifford McCullough, II.

A private ceremony is being held for immediate family members.
